#542d3e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#542d3e is composed of 32.9% red, 17.6%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.4% magenta, 26.2%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 333.8 degrees, a saturation of 30.2% and a lightness of 25.3%. #542d3e color hex could be obtained by blending #a85a7c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#542d3e color description : Very dark desaturated pink.
#542d3e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#542d3e has RGB values of R:84, G:45,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.26,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5516606.

Shades and Tints of #542d3e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070405 is the darkest color, while #fcfafb is the lightest one.
